Output 666809f9f5a00733c69b06b2bdf4efade3fedd197c85d6b856bd7d74b4be1e04:0

value
1341865
script pubkey
OP_0 OP_PUSHBYTES_20 3c3fc7bd279b2934454010a72e14ae1ba6197388
address
bc1q8slu00f8nv5ng32qzznju99wrwnpjuug6e3ylx
transaction
666809f9f5a00733c69b06b2bdf4efade3fedd197c85d6b856bd7d74b4be1e04